It is a particularly exciting and significant time to be joining Westminster. As part of Westminster Under School and Westminster School’s move to become fully co-educational, girls will be joining the Under School for the first time in September 2026, at the 7+ and 11+ entry points, and a brand-new pre-prep will open for boys and girls at the 4+ entry point. In 2028, girls will be joining at 13+ at Westminster School.
Our Reception will cultivate a love of learning, both through formal and child-initiated activities, and there will be plenty of opportunities to explore the outdoors, both on our new play balcony and on Vincent Square, our 13-acre private playing field. High-quality adult interactions will prepare children for a stimulating and world-class education in Year 1 and beyond.
The role
Westminster Under School is looking for two exceptional Early Years Educators to join our Pre-Prep Team. This role goes far beyond that of a traditional Teaching Assistant. In Reception, our Early Years Educators are deeply involved in direct teaching, supporting children’s learning, development, and early foundations every day. It’s a highly skilled and impactful position, central to shaping our pupils’ first experiences of school. The two postholders will assist the class teacher in delivering engaging and developmentally appropriate activities that support children’s progress across the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S). Outside of lessons, they will supervise pupils during playtimes and assist with educational visits, as well as fulfil a range of administrative and practical tasks.
Applicants will need a Level 3 qualification in Early Years Education and Childcare (or equivalent), and will be committed to continuing professional development. Experience of working with children in Early Years is essential. The successful candidate will be an excellent communicator who is empathetic and compassionate, with a good understanding of boundaries. Strong organisational and administrative skills, with the ability to plan, prioritise and manage a varied workload, are integral to the role. They will be an outstanding classroom practitioner who can build and maintain effective relationships with all members of the school community and inspire and motivate pupils.
This is a permanent, full-time, term-time only role. The salary is £25,124.62 – £28,000 per year (actual) equating to a full-time equivalent of £33,548.76 – £37,387.40 per annum, depending on experience.
